WebNov 28, 2024 · You may need another mammogram or further tests, or the radiologist wants to compare current findings to older mammograms. 1. Negative. A typical test result; it means the radiologist found nothing abnormal. 2. Benign. This may be used instead of a 1 when a radiologist notes lumps or lymph nodes that are noncancerous.
